现代优化方法学习教案:启发式算法与旅行商问题探究
版权申诉
175 浏览量
更新于2024-02-23
收藏 347KB PPTX 举报
现代优化方法是一个涵盖了人工神经网络、遗传算法、禁忌搜索算法、模拟退火算法、蚁群算法等多种算法的领域。这些算法都是基于一些直观的基础而构建的,被称之为启发式算法,有人认为现代优化算法主要指的是仿生算法。这些算法涉及的学科非常广泛,包括生物进化、人工智能、数学和物理、神经系统和统计力学等。这些算法与人工智能、计算机科学和运筹学等领域相融合,为解决各种实际问题提供了强大的工具和方法。
传统算法在处理一些复杂性较高的问题时往往面临局限性,比如旅行商问题。旅行商问题指的是一个商人需要到达n个城市推销商品,每两个城市之间的距离已知,商人需要选择一条最短的路径使得每个城市都被访问一次后回到起点。而非对称旅行商问题则更为复杂,需要枚举n-1个城市的所有可能路径来求解,随着城市数量的增加,所需时间呈指数级增长。这种复杂性使得传统算法很难有效解决这类问题,而现代优化方法则提供了更为高效和有效的解决方案。
在现代优化方法中,人工神经网络、遗传算法、禁忌搜索算法、模拟退火算法、蚁群算法等被广泛应用于各种实际问题的优化求解中。这些算法通过模拟自然界的各种进化和搜索策略,实现了在复杂问题中找到最优解的能力。人工神经网络模拟了人脑神经元的工作原理,可以用于模式识别、分类、预测等领域;遗传算法模拟了自然界中的遗传和进化过程,可以用于求解优化问题;禁忌搜索算法通过记录禁忌表和禁忌搜索,避免局部最优解;模拟退火算法则模拟了物体退火时的温度变化过程,以跳出局部最优解;蚁群算法模拟了蚂蚁在寻找食物时的沟通和合作行为,用于解决路线规划等问题。
总的来说,现代优化方法为解决复杂的优化问题提供了强大的工具和方法,这些方法不仅有效解决了传统算法所面临的局限性,而且在各个领域都有着广泛的应用前景。随着人工智能和计算机科学的发展,现代优化方法将会在更多领域展现出其强大的实用性和潜力,为人类社会的发展提供更多的支持和帮助。
2024-11-05 上传
2024-11-09 上传
2024-11-02 上传
2024-11-09 上传
2024-11-03 上传
2024-11-25 上传

shenlanzhijia
- 粉丝: 2
最新资源
- 掌握MATLAB中不同SVM工具箱的多类分类与函数拟合应用
- 易窗颜色抓取软件:简单绿色工具
- VS2010中使用QT连接MySQL数据库测试程序源码解析
- PQEngine:PHP图形用户界面(GUI)库的深入探索
- MeteorFriends: 管理朋友请求与好友列表的JavaScript程序包
- 第三届微步情报大会:深入解析网络安全的最新趋势
- IQ测试软件V1.3.0.0正式版发布:功能优化与错误修复
- 全面技术项目源码合集:企业级HTML5网页与实践指南
- VC++6.0绿色完整版兼容多系统安装指南
- 支付宝即时到账收款与退款接口详解
- 新型不连续导电模式V_2C控制Boost变换器分析
- 深入解析快速排序算法的C++实现
- 利用MyBatis实现Oracle映射文件自动生成
- vim-autosurround插件:智能化管理代码中的括号与引号
- Bitmap转byte[]实例教程与应用
- Qt YUV在CentOS 7下的亲测Demo教程